One of the top wide receivers and free agent Amari Cooper is still available on the market but should sign soon with a contender. Cooper is on every top free agent list across several sources but, oddly, he’s still available. Even though the Buffalo Bills are open to bringing back the wide receiver, the team hasn’t made the steps to re-sign him to a new contract. It’s an interesting storyline to follow here this offseason as the former Pro Bowler is entering age 30 and his prime days are almost behind him.
Originally selected in the first round of the 2015 NFL Draft, the former Alabama product came into the league as one of the better pass catchers beginning his career with the Las Vegas Raiders. The wide receiver recorded back-to-back 1,000-yard seasons and two Pro Bowl appearances in his rookie and sophomore campaigns. Cooper was slow to get anything going in his third year with them leading to a trade to the Dallas Cowboys becoming the prime target for Dak Prescott’s offense. Cooper was the best receiver on that team since the Dez Bryant days before losing his touch following the emergence of CeeDee Lamb.
The veteran went to the Browns and despite having a low-quality quarterback, it didn’t stop him from recording high-end numbers. Cooper couldn’t get much going last season after suffering an injury since his trade midseason hoping for a Super Bowl opportunity. It might be the injury that’s holding any team from pursuing him but when healthy, he’s one of the best pass-catchers out there. These two contenders could bank on the opportunity and sign him to a one-year deal.

Rebuilding the Panthers
The Carolina Panthers are solid on the offensive side after establishing two wide receivers that have plenty of promise. After bringing quarterback Bryce Young back to life, the Panthers have a good chance of having a better 2025 season but that can’t happen without adding another capable veteran. Xavier Legette and Jalen Coker are the future of this passing game that will help Young grow but if they want to see results, they should give Cooper a chance. The wide receiver has been a part of a rebuilding team before and he could do the same with the Panthers who are still in those stages.
Head Coach Dave Canales could fit Cooper and veteran Adam Thielen as two wide receivers who could rotate in that department. Bryce Young won’t get far without some pass catchers who have experience. Cooper might not be the same but if he can stay healthy, the Panthers aren’t losing anything if they bank on him for a one-year contract.
Super Bowl Hero?
The Kansas City Chiefs are entering the 2025 season with a weird dilemma at the wide receiver position. Despite re-signing Marquise Brown, it might be enough firepower for Patrick Mahomes. The quarterback didn’t have the best season to his standards even though the team only lost one game. However, depending on what happens with Xavier Worthy and Rashee Rice, the team may need another wideout.
Both of those weapons are one off-field issue away from suspension and the Chiefs can’t risk betting on them both. Cooper stays out of trouble so they should give him an opportunity who has a lot of upside and a humble spirit that can fit well in Kansas City.
